7.4/10

Supanote

Lightweight therapy scribe with a real free tier

Low-friction entry point. Free tier and inexpensive paid plan, basic SOAP/DAP/BIRP formats covered, HIPAA-aligned with BAA on paid plans. Provisional pending our own clinical-quality testing.

8.2/10

Blueprint

Measurement-based care platform with an ambient AI note layer

Distinct from a pure scribe — Blueprint started as a measurement-based-care platform and now ships an ambient note layer that ties session content to outcome measures (PHQ-9, GAD-7, etc.). Useful if you want one tool for both. HIPAA-aligned with BAA. Pricing is published per-clinician with a free trial. Note quality is solid on standard talk-therapy formats; specialty templates are narrower than Mentalyc or Upheal.

Bottom line

Pick Supanote if you need solo therapists trialing ai documentation without commitment. Pick Blueprint if you need therapists who want progress notes plus measurement-based-care outcomes in one workflow. Verify on a live session before committing — both publish trials or free tiers worth using.
